Taskmaster Resources currently have an excellent opportunity for Production Labourer in Rotherham area.

Working hours: Monday to Friday: 08.00 - 16.30

Payrate: £13p/h

Key Responsibilities:

  • Paint spraying of wooden panels
  • Sanding and filling surfaces to a high standard
  • General factory and production duties
  • Maintaining a clean and safe work environment

What We're Looking For:

  • Good attention to detail
  • Ability to work as part of a team
  • Willingness to learn and follow instructions
  • Previous factory or paint spraying experience is an advantage but not essential
